According to the 2022 nations ranking given by the World Athletics, Kenyan male runners put up a fantastic performance in international competitions in the just finished season. With 46 points, the East African athletic powerhouse was ranked second, 18 points ahead of Great Britain in third. The United States, which is hosting the World Athletics Championships, finished first on the log with an astounding 118 points.

However, despite giving Kenya some trouble in Oregon, Ethiopia, Kenya's arch-rival, settled for fifth place, behind Canada and Jamaica. Because they earned the same number of points (20) as their East African rivals, Ethiopia, Uganda was also rated fifth in the log. The only other country from Africa to make the top 10 was South Africa, which came in at number 10. A medal at the World Athletics Championship went to Kenya thanks in part to the runners Emmanuel Korir, Stanley Waithaka Mburu, and Ferdinand Omurwa Omanyala.

Ethiopia placed higher than fourth-placed Kenya in the women's division. With 75 points, Jamaica barely edged out the United States for first place. With 74 and 60 points, respectively, the latter and Ethiopia accepted second and third place. Kenyan female athletes finished fourth alongside Great Britain with a total season score of 39. Except for Faith Kipyegon Chepngetich, female athletes Mary Moraa, Beatrice Chebet, and Judith Korir all had below-average performances in 2022.
